In order to solve the problems, the invention provides a project supervision information management method, a project supervision information management system, an intelligent terminal and a storage medium based on a BIM technology and cloud computing for an assembled building, an original design assembly three-dimensional model of each assembly process corresponding to the assembled building is constructed by adopting the BIM technology and is used as a statistical basis of budget construction cost, and the problems mentioned in the background technology are effectively solved.
The purpose of the invention can be realized by the following technical scheme:
in a first aspect, the invention provides an engineering supervision information management method based on a BIM technology and cloud computing, which comprises the following steps:
s1, assembling procedure counting and assembling model obtaining, namely counting assembling procedures corresponding to the assembled building through an assembling procedure counting and assembling model obtaining module, numbering the counted assembling procedures according to the assembling sequence, sequentially marking the assembling procedures as 1,2, 1, i, n, and simultaneously obtaining an original design assembling three-dimensional model corresponding to each assembling procedure;
s2, collecting construction cost parameters of original design assembly materials of the assembly process, namely collecting the construction cost parameters of the original design assembly materials corresponding to each assembly process from the original design assembly three-dimensional model corresponding to each assembly process through an assembly process original design assembly material construction cost parameter collecting module;
s3, collecting construction cost parameters of the original design splicing materials of the assembly processes, namely counting the number of the assembly splicing positions corresponding to each assembly process from the original design assembly three-dimensional models corresponding to each assembly process through an assembly process original design splicing material construction cost parameter collecting module, numbering the counted assembly splicing positions, marking the counted assembly splicing positions as 1,2, a.
S4, counting the price of the original design comprehensive assembly material of the assembly process, namely analyzing the cost parameter of the original design assembly material corresponding to each assembly process and the cost parameter of the original design splicing material at each assembly splicing position corresponding to each assembly process according to an assembly process cost analysis module so as to count the price of the original design comprehensive assembly material corresponding to each assembly process;
s5, determining the manual assembly man-hour of the original design of the assembly process, namely focusing the three-dimensional model of the original design assembly corresponding to each assembly process at each assembly splicing position through an assembly process original design manual assembly man-hour determining module, collecting the splicing height, the splicing angle and the splicing sectional area of each assembly process corresponding to each assembly splicing position, calculating the original design assembly difficulty coefficient of each assembly process corresponding to each assembly splicing position, and determining the manual assembly man-hour of the original design corresponding to each assembly splicing position of each assembly process according to the original design assembly man-hour;
s6, counting the original design manual assembly price of the assembly process, namely analyzing the original design manual assembly time of each assembly process corresponding to each assembly splicing part according to an assembly process cost analysis module so as to count the original design manual assembly price corresponding to each assembly process;
s7, acquiring the actual comprehensive assembly material price of the assembly process, namely acquiring the actual comprehensive assembly material price corresponding to each assembly process in the actual assembly work according to an actual comprehensive assembly material price acquisition module of the assembly process;
s8, counting actual manual assembly prices of the assembly processes, namely counting the actual manual assembly hours of the assembly splicing positions corresponding to the assembly processes according to an actual manual assembly price counting module of the assembly processes, analyzing the actual manual assembly hours, and counting the actual manual assembly prices corresponding to the assembly processes;
s9, evaluating the construction cost quality coefficient of the assembly procedures, namely comparing the original design comprehensive assembly material price corresponding to each assembly procedure with the actual comprehensive assembly material price through a construction cost supervision server, evaluating the construction cost quality coefficient of the assembly material corresponding to each assembly procedure, comparing the original design manual assembly price corresponding to each assembly procedure with the actual manual assembly price, and evaluating the manual assembly construction cost quality coefficient corresponding to each assembly procedure;
s10, assembly process cost sequencing display, namely sequencing each assembly process according to the sequence of the assembly material cost quality coefficient and the manual assembly cost quality coefficient from small to large through a cost display module to obtain the assembly material cost quality sequencing result and the manual assembly cost quality sequencing result corresponding to each assembly process, and displaying the sequencing results.

Based on any one of the above aspects, the invention has the following beneficial effects:
1. the invention acquires the corresponding assembly processes of the prefabricated building according to the corresponding assembly processes of the prefabricated building, acquires the original design assembly three-dimensional model corresponding to each assembly process, further acquires the original design assembly material cost parameter corresponding to each assembly process and the original design assembly material cost parameter at each assembly splicing position according to the original design assembly three-dimensional model, thereby counting the original design comprehensive assembly material price corresponding to each assembly process, simultaneously determines the original design manual assembly working hours at each assembly splicing position corresponding to each assembly process according to the original design assembly three-dimensional model, thereby counting the original design manual assembly price corresponding to each assembly process, thereby obtaining the budget cost corresponding to each assembly process, the statistical method of the budget cost adopts the BIM technology to construct the original design assembly three-dimensional model corresponding to each assembly process of the prefabricated building, the method is used as the statistical basis of the budget cost, overcomes the defect that the traditional budget cost statistical mode of the house building engineering does not have a solid model as the statistical basis, improves the accuracy of the budget cost statistical result, avoids the phenomenon of overlarge statistical error, provides reliable budget cost parameters for the later-stage assembly house building cost supervision, and is favorable for improving the accuracy and the reliability of the cost supervision evaluation result.
2. According to the invention, the quantitative display of the in-out condition between the actual comprehensive assembly material price and the original design comprehensive assembly material price of each assembly process and the in-out condition between the actual manual assembly price and the original design manual assembly price is realized by evaluating the assembly material cost quality coefficient and the manual assembly cost quality coefficient corresponding to each assembly process, the cost supervision result of each assembly process is visually displayed, and the supervision result is more visual.
3. According to the invention, the assembly processes are respectively sequenced according to the sequence of the corresponding assembly material cost quality coefficient and the manual assembly cost quality coefficient from small to large, the sequencing result visually shows the assembly material cost quality condition and the manual assembly cost quality condition corresponding to each assembly process to the supervisor, and sequencing basis is provided for the supervisor to the management priority sequence of the assembly material cost control management and the manual assembly cost control management of each assembly process.
